I'm looking for a new sleeping bag (or quilt) that is spacious enough (I hate feeling cramped) and in a subdued color (brown, green, grey, etc). A Snugpak Softie 9 Hawk is available in a nice dark coyote brown color and it has an optional Expanda Panel that can be purchased to widen the bag. Both items can be had for approx $229.00 together. Now, I briefly had a center zip Kifaru slick bag (long/wide) that was spacious enough and comfortable. It definitely felt like a quality bag. However, it's also about $200 more plus the 5 string stuff sack if you go that route. Anyone have experience with both bags or can recommend another bag based on what I'm looking for? (Spacious and subdued colors). For the record I'm about 5'11" and 205 lbs.
